Output 171b53e122c524d0c8237e44045bcc497f70ff9d324c7c25d94c8b41d123ef9c:5

value
26465336
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d30aed20ec0b51de871ae5ece3d9136e7b81a51 OP_EQUALVERIFY OP_CHECKSIG
address
LTihRbkQxNPBBtXTpEfwUYmGeVTAe3DNMY
transaction
171b53e122c524d0c8237e44045bcc497f70ff9d324c7c25d94c8b41d123ef9c
spent
true